Abstract
We show, using a simple model, how ordinary disorder can gap an extended- s - (A1g) symmetry superconducting state with nodes. The concomitant crossover of thermodynamic properties, particularly the T dependence of the superfluid density, from pure power-law behavior to an activated one is exhibited. We discuss applications of this scenario to experiments on the ferropnictide superconductors.
